Gridline Communications, Inc. Announces Plan to Acquire Portal of the Americas, Inc.


HOUSTON, Feb. 8, 2006 (PRIMEZONE) -- Gridline Communications, Inc., a Texas-based corporation, announced today that the company has entered into a memorandum of understanding (MOU) with Portal of the Americas, Inc. to integrate all of the content contained within the multinational, multi-lingual Education Portal of America, currently hosted by the Organization of American States (OAS) and the new Portal of the Americas platform targeting universities medical centers, enterprises and municipal governments, with Gridline Communications' offerings. The MOU is the first step in the next phase of Gridline's long-term efforts to offer a complete end-to-end Internet solution containing a host of valuable online content and services available on the new Platform via electrical outlets, utilizing the patented Gridline broadband data-over-power-line BPL technology.

Portal of the Americas is a web-based content service aggregator and provider. The next generation portal platform provides access and distribution of over 2,000 distance learning programs in all areas of knowledge. It also serves as a common interface platform for multiple digital libraries, and a variety of personal services and applications. Portal of the Americas works with key partners in the region such as the Organization of American States through its Advance Studies Institute for the Americas (INEAM) and the Ibero-American Science and Technology Consortium (ISTEC) of over 160 universities and 20 global companies and government institutions. Under the terms of the MOU, subject to approval of the board of directors and shareholders, Gridline will merge Portal of America and its content into Gridline and the Portal system will become the primary platform for Gridline's growing library of content. Gridline will also enter into employment and/or consulting agreements with the key employees of Portal of America.

About Portal of the Americas

Portal of the Americas, Inc., a Nevada "C"corporation, holds content and provisioning license for the Educational Portal of America, a web-based platform formed through an initiative of the Inter-American Agency for Cooperation and Development (IACD) of the Organization of American States. This license provides for the commercialization of the content and services currently available on the Portal as well as expanding the Portal through introduction of new and innovative content and services, initially targeted at the 18 to 25 age group. These services are consistent with the IACD's mission to forge new private/public-sector partnerships to help the people of the Hemisphere overcome poverty, benefit from the digital revolution and advance their economic and social development. The development of the Educational Portal has been made possible through a Cooperation Fund established by the United States and through strategic alliances with public and private-sector institutions. About Gridline Communications Corp.

Gridline Communications Holdings, Inc. is a Texas-based corporation focused on Broadband over Power Line (BPL) deployment using proven BPL technologies, coupled with proprietary intellectual properties, to provide high-speed broadband connectivity and a variety of market-driven applications such as Voiceover Internet Protocol (VoIP) telephony, security, streaming video, telemedicine, and long-distance learning. Gridline's products are capable of reaching over 87 percent of the world's population without investing the significant additional infrastructure capital costs typically required with telecom copper wire, radio towers, or fiber networks.
